Q: Is 310,881 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 310,881 is a composite number.

Why is 310,881 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 310,881 can be evenly divided by 1 3 173 519 599 1,797 103,627 and 310,881, with no remainder.

Since 310,881 cannot be divided by just 1 and 310,881, it is a composite number.
